40 Years of Dedication

In June of 1982, Kelly Brokenborough started a new job at Quest’s Laurel Hill Intermediate Care Facility. What started as a job turned into a career of changing people’s lives for 40 years. The Quest team recently had a chance to celebrate her four decades of service with a surprise anniversary party.

“Miss Kelly,” as she’s affectionately called by her colleagues and the residents at Laurel Hill, has worn many hats through her decades of service. She now runs the kitchen for the home, preparing meals for the specialized diets each of the residents. Her positive and caring spirit is infectious in the home and she’s known as a godmother to residents and staff alike.

“Miss Kelly is the epitome of graceful service,” said John R. Gill, Quest’s President and CEO. “She leads with her heart and she leads by example. Her impact has literally affected generations of Quest residents and staff. We are really fortunate and honored to have her not just as a team member, but as a guide to all of us on how to approach life.”

In honor of this tremendous milestone, Quest has dedicated and renamed the kitchen at Lauren Hill, the “Miss Kelly Kitchen.” We thank Miss Kelly for her decades of service and for being a shining light within the Quest family!
